Default 2002 Accord Intermittent Horn Failure

My 2002 Honda Accord has developed an intermittent horn failure problem. When I turn my steering wheel in either direction, the horn will work. When I keep the steering wheel straight, the horn stops working. When I make a turn onto another street and then drive straight, the horn will work until I turn the wheel slightly such as drive around a parked car. Is it the cable reel, bent horn plate, or something else?
